No shower or tub water

Just got camper out of winter storage and was making sure everything works. I can get water out of all faucets except bathtub? This happens on both cold and hot also on both fresh water or city water hookup. Don’t remember shutting any valves off when closing it down? Any thoughts??

Does your shower head have a "pause" valve? That's a push in plastic valve to shut the water off at the shower head so you can soap up and not waste water. If that is engaged and the water diverted to the shower head you won't get water out.
